Accessing the Walmart Pay Center
The journey to managing your pay begins with secure access to the Walmart pay portal. Associates use their unique Walmart identification number, often linked to their employee profile, as the primary login credential. This system is designed to protect sensitive data while providing a streamlined experience for viewing current and historical pay information.
Step-by-Step Login Process
Open your preferred web browser and navigate to the official Walmart pay login page.
Enter your Walmart ID and associated password in the designated fields.
Complete any required security verification, such as a CAPTCHA or two-factor authentication prompt.
Click the login button to access your personalized dashboard.
Understanding Your Pay Stubs
Once logged in, the pay stub section provides a transparent breakdown of your earnings for each pay period. You can see detailed information regarding regular hours, overtime, bonuses, and deductions. This level of detail ensures that every dollar earned is accounted for and easily verifiable.

Managing Direct Deposit
Setting up or updating direct deposit is a critical feature that ensures your earnings are deposited accurately and on time. Through the pay portal, you can verify that the correct bank account is linked and make changes if your financial situation evolves. This eliminates the need for physical paychecks and provides faster access to your funds.
Viewing Historical Earnings
For tax preparation or personal budgeting, the ability to review past pay records is invaluable. The Walmart pay system allows you to access archived pay stubs and W-2 forms from previous years. This functionality simplifies the process of reconciling annual income and ensures you have the documentation you need when filing taxes.
